Caratteri delle stringhe in Python
Possiamo accedere a qualsiasi carattere di una stringa utilizzando il suo indice (numero d'ordine), racchiuso tra parentesi quadre:
txt = 'abcde'
print(txt[1]) # stamperà 'b'
Nota che la numerazione dei caratteri inizia da zero.
È anche possibile trovare un carattere dalla fine della stringa.
Per fare questo, scriviamo il suo numero con il segno meno.
In questo caso, l'ultimo carattere avrà
l'indice -1:
txt = 'abcde'
print(txt[-1]) # stamperà 'e'
Data la stringa:
txt = 'abcdef'
Stampa in console il primo carattere di questa stringa.
Data la stringa:
txt = 'abcdef'
Stampa in console il secondo carattere di questa stringa.
Data la stringa:
txt = 'abcdef'
Stampa in console l'ultimo carattere di questa stringa.
Data la stringa:
txt = 'abcdef'
Stampa in console il penultimo carattere di questa stringa.